Characters I Love: Althea and Markon

More adorable characters from W.R. Gingell! Althea and Markon are the two main characters in Twelve Days of Faery. Althea is confident and competent, magnificently understated, and somehow adorable rather than intimidating. She’s kind and funny and endearing, while remaining supremely focused on her mission. She’s quite understandably fascinating to Markon (and to the reader), and she’s a wonderful example of a “strong female character” who isn’t written as a physically rough-and-tough sex symbol with too much attitude.
